This release changes the default behaviour of the Parceldove parcel-tracking webhook. Previously, delivery events were batched on a fixed five-minute window and retried indefinitely on failure, which caused duplicate notifications during the Kellering outage. Batching is now adaptive, retries are capped, and the signing scheme defaults to the v2 digest. Future maintainers should note that any consumer still expecting the old window will see faster but smaller payloads. The new defaults shipped with 2.9 are recorded below.

config for kagup-hahig:
druwyn:
  pin: 2801
  metrics_host: metrics.druwyn.zemvarlabs.internal
  tenant: sorius
  seal: seal_798a43d7

Prepared for branch managers of Corvane Logistics.

We are evaluating the acquisition of Tellbrook Freight, a regional carrier operating out of Marrow Bay. Due diligence to date shows stable margins, an aging fleet, and overlapping routes that would consolidate well with our eastern corridor. Integration costs are estimated at the mid-range of earlier projections. No approach has been made public, and branch staff should not be informed at this stage. The confidential note on business plans follows immediately below.

confidential, bageg-bahap: Only 9 of the 80 pilot accounts renewed Wenael, so a churn review is set for April 15.

Changed defaults in Splitfork, our assignment service. Bucketing now uses sticky hashing per account instead of per session, and the holdout slice grew from 2% to 5%. Callers relying on session-level reassignment must opt in explicitly. Review the diff against the new baseline; the updated default configuration is listed below.

config for tagep-kajof:
[casir]
port = 6379
region = south-1
host = casir.paliqdyn.example
team = tamax
timeout_ms = 250
retries = 2